Transaction 95f961378badb37959922088de82384a5be843ea9df31e6477d5b7128dea2dba
1 Input
1 Output
-
95f961378badb37959922088de82384a5be843ea9df31e6477d5b7128dea2dba:0
- value
- 67728063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f40c51466901e09d707bd9809db7fb4656fde9b6 OP_EQUAL
- address
- 3PwRZBd1LVgSY68NLpUHbbUthuqdV1a86k